St Johns River Steak & Seafood
550 N Palmetto Ave, Sanford
(407) 878-0980
Recent Reviews
Sort by
Atmosphere: {{ item.info.Atmosphere }}
Food: {{ item.info.Food }}
Service: {{ item.info.Service }}
Recommended dishes: {{ item.info['Recommended dishes'] }}
Our family of 11 stopped here for lunch as we were passing through. No one was disappointed. We will now seek this place out next time we are around. The server was very kind, just a bit slower than I would've thought even for a large group.
Atmosphere: 5
Food: 5
Service: 4
Awesome food and the best bartender Jennifer. Love the view too.
Atmosphere: 5
Food: 5
Service: 5
the view, the food and the bartender jen keep me coming back! she makes great irish coffees!!
Atmosphere: 5
Food: 5
Service: 5
Jennifer did a great job showing me a good time and finding the perfect menu option. Love her Long Island iced teas too
Atmosphere: 5
Food: 5
Service: 5
First time there and absolutely loved everything. Service, food, drinks and prices. I will be back!
Atmosphere: 5
Food: 5
Service: 5
We go about once a month and consistently appreciate the professional, friendly service of the bartender Jen. Her attention to detail is top notch.
Atmosphere: 4
Food: 5
Service: 5
My guy and I really enjoyed the food. The food is well seasoned and the portion size is enough for two people to eat from 1 plate. The service is a little different than what I am used to. So we had our main server but when he walked away someone else came over and took our order. Then after that person walked away someone else came over to check on us. The manager explained to us they all work together. It's not a bad thing just different. We sat on the enclosed patio with the beautiful view of the river. We will definitely dine there again.
Atmosphere: 5
Food: 5
Service: 5
Our bartender Jen is amazing! Great food great service and amazing drinks
Atmosphere: 5
Food: 5
Service: 5
If the gods of hospitality ever walked among us, Jennifer at St. John’s River Steak & Seafood in Sanford, FL would be their chosen champion. I’ve dined across this planet — from hole-in-the-wall diners to Michelin-star temples of gastronomy — and never, not once, have I witnessed the level of service that Jennifer delivered. This wasn’t just a meal. This was an event. A masterclass. A symphony of timing, kindness, and precision that would make even the most seasoned maître d’ drop their notepad in awe.
From the instant I arrived, Jennifer radiated a confidence and grace that could tame chaos itself. You could drop her into the middle of Napoleon’s army, and she’d have the troops fed, hydrated, and smiling before the first cannon fired. She has the situational awareness of Sun Tzu, the charm of Cleopatra, and the work ethic of a NASA mission control crew. Nothing escaped her notice. My glass never went empty. My plate never lingered cold. And yet she made it all look effortless — as if she was conducting invisible strings behind the entire restaurant.
Jennifer doesn’t serve tables — she commands an atmosphere. Every word she speaks carries a rhythm, every gesture a sense of purpose. She knew the menu like a scholar reciting ancient scripture, and every recommendation she made was a revelation. When she described a dish, it wasn’t just food — it was prophecy. And when it arrived, it was exactly as promised. Not close. Not good enough. Perfect.
At one point, I sat back and thought, “This is what Alexander the Great must’ve felt like when he realized there were no more worlds to conquer.” Because after being served by Jennifer, there are no higher peaks of customer service left to climb.
In a world where so many people simply go through the motions, Jennifer reminded me that excellence isn’t extinct — it’s just rare. She’s the Michelangelo of menu mastery, the Beethoven of timing, the Serena Williams of multitasking. If NASA ever opens a restaurant on Mars, they should recruit Jennifer to train the entire staff.
The food at St. John’s River Steak & Seafood? Outstanding. The atmosphere? Beautiful, with that classic riverside charm that feels like home. But what elevated this from great dinner to once-in-a-lifetime experience was Jennifer — the human embodiment of five stars.
If you’re reading this, stop scrolling and make a reservation. Request Jennifer. Trust me — she’s not just the best waitress I’ve ever had; she’s a living legend in the making. One day, people will tell stories of how they dined here, and how Jennifer turned an ordinary evening into something eternal.
Thank you, Jennifer. You didn’t just set the standard — you became it.
Atmosphere: 3
Food: 4
Service: 5
Me and my husband love this place, great date night out. Food is always delicious. Servers are friendly and attentive, Jennifer made our evening perfect. Highly recommend!
Atmosphere: 5
Food: 5
Service: 5
Restaurantji Recommends
I just celebrated my anniversary here with my husband. The service from Jennifer is just impeccable. The best service I've had in years.
Atmosphere: 5
Food: 5
Service: 5
It was so lovely sitting and seeing the water the bartender Jennifer made me a few fantastic drinks an really made my day with 5 star service an speed
Atmosphere: 4
Food: 3
Service: 5
I go here all the time. The food is good. I always like to sit at the bar, do some magic and have some drinks. Jenn is my absolute favorite server. She is who makes this place a 5 star restaurant.
Atmosphere: 5
Food: 5
Service: 5
Jennifer The Best Bartender at Waterfront St John's She is on it (:
Atmosphere: 5
Food: 5
Service: 5
Jennifer is so great never had better service than from her!. Best ever in service.!m conversation.. recommendations of food . Clean up of are you name it and it’s done!!$
Atmosphere: 5
Food: 5
Service: 5
Loading...